    The SAP error message UJXO_META_EXCEPTION013 indicates that there is an issue with retrieving master data for a specific dimension in a given model and environment. This error typically occurs in SAP Analytics Cloud (SAC) or SAP BW/4HANA environments when there is a problem with the metadata or the connection to the data source.
    Causes:
    
    Missing or Incomplete Master Data: The master data for the specified dimension may not exist or may be incomplete in the underlying data source.
    Connection Issues: There may be connectivity issues between SAP Analytics Cloud and the data source, preventing the retrieval of master data.
    Model Configuration: The model may not be properly configured to access the required dimension or master data.
    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ary permissions to access the master data in the specified environment or model.
